Mariners star pitcher Felix Hernandez left Wednesday's game against the Twins in the first inning for precautionary reasons due to tightness in his right elbow.

Hernandez retired just one batter while allowing two runs on two hits and two walks before the trainers came out of the dugout and lifted him with a 3-1 count on Justin Morneau.

He will be re-examined Thursday.
